The suffering stems were doing alright last year and pushing off new growth but now im losing them, is there a way to save them or no? WebMar 8, 2024 · Fluoride Toxicity. Fluorine naturally occurs in air and water, but fluoride salts when present in a high concentration can lead to a phenomenon known as fluoride toxicity in certain plants which results in brown leaf tips and edges. On a spider plant, the long slender shape of the leaves and its sharp tip results in just the tips turning brown ...
